IKO - NGC6888 Crescent Nebula SHO Data Release - December 2023

I am sorry it has been so long since the last data release but I hope to post some more regularly from here onwards assuming people find it useful / interesting 🙂

This release is slightly different as it was taken from one of the 90mm StellaMira rigs from our https://www.remoteobservatory.com/ project. This started at over 270 hours of data that I have very aggressively whittled down to the best 120 hours. 

You can see the full list of equipment used here. The data isn't perfect - I didn't notice until processing the corner stars suggest the reducer spacing needs a slight adjustment but the data is so deep I wanted to share and see what other people can pull out of it.

This image was processed in the Pixinsight Weighted Batch Pre-Processor and comprises:

  • Ha - 652 x 5 mins
  • OIII - 389 x 5 mins
  • SII - 402 x 5 mins
  • Flats 21x for each filter
  • Darks 21x 5 mins
  • Flat Darks

These have been stacked and calibrated in Pixinsight. The raw XISF, FITS or TIF files can be downloaded here.
